Вопросы по теме 'file-pointer'

Что такое режим указателя файла?
Что это за указатель режима, что это за режим, 'insert' или overwrite ? Поскольку я новичок в file pointer в C, возможно, мой вопрос довольно глупый. Мне очень жаль, если кто-то это чувствует. И что я могу сделать, если хочу insert some...
194 просмотров
schedule 13.10.2021

Python-эквивалент opendir в Perl
По сути, я ищу способ вернуть дескриптор каталога в python, немного похоже на то, как perl может делать что-то вроде этого ... opendir CWD . см. http://perldoc.perl.org/5.8.9/functions/opendir.html Затем CWD можно использовать в качестве...
1028 просмотров
schedule 22.05.2022

Использование функции fread: размер для чтения больше, чем доступный для чтения
У меня есть вопрос: Я использую fread для чтения файла. typedef struct { int ID1; int ID2; char string[256]; } Reg; Reg *A = (Reg*) malloc(sizeof(Reg)*size); size = FILESIZE/sizeof(Reg); fread (A, sizeof(Reg), size, FILEREAD);...
6201 просмотров
schedule 10.07.2022

Приведение к указателю файла
Я настраиваю файловую систему FUSE, и мне нужно получить указатель на любые открытые файлы, чтобы я мог шифровать их по мере их записи. В системе FUSE используется специальная структура. Один из компонентов структуры называется fh и имеет тип...
2142 просмотров
schedule 23.04.2023

fopen приводит к segfault
Как в заголовке. Простое упражнение, пытающееся изучить структуры и другие важные функции c. Вот структура, содержащая char[] и число, я пытаюсь сохранить его значения в файле и прочитать их обратно. Я прочитал много тем, касающихся Seg.fault от...
1315 просмотров
schedule 10.04.2023

Передать указатель FILE* из Swift в функцию C
Я использую libxml в своем проекте iOS Swift. Для отладки мне нужно вызвать следующую функцию C из Swift: void xmlDebugDumpString (FILE * output, const xmlChar * r) Однако я не знаю, как создать указатель FILE * output в Swift. Я...
578 просмотров
schedule 25.05.2023

Запись Pipe перезаписывает выделенное пространство памяти
Моя программа довольно большая, поэтому я выделю основную проблему и добавлю некоторые подробности о ней. Первая часть моего кода: int myPipe[2]; //A global variable, so I don't have to pass it to future functions int main(int argc, char...
21 просмотров
schedule 23.04.2023